Are You More Like Goofus...or More Like Gallant?

Goofus and Gallant® may look pretty young, but they are actually older than Highlights magazine. The magazine's founder, Garry Cleveland Myers, first used the two characters to promote family discussion and teach children to develop their own code of conduct in the 1930s. When the feature began, they weren't even boys. They were elves with pointy little ears!

Goofus and Gallant appeared in Highlights in 1948 and ever since have shown its youthful readers that there are two ways to act in a situation—the Goofus way and the Gallant way. We hope they'll choose the Gallant way, but we know that even adults don't manage that all the time.
